Transaction 76e967977842ec7caf7667b0f8f9eda2e948a6f0a6e379c1cf355d32e6639073
1 Input
2 Outputs
- 76e967977842ec7caf7667b0f8f9eda2e948a6f0a6e379c1cf355d32e6639073:0
- 76e967977842ec7caf7667b0f8f9eda2e948a6f0a6e379c1cf355d32e6639073:1
value 17904363
address 146c7Zsj1pKDyEqvvcLKyLsosrfSFeJZyT
value 6239480
address 3NJHKS4CpybxWtZtKfX8atdeo4cTxETrjr